WHO INTERNATIONAL DIGEST OF HEALTH LEGISLATION

The Whole Health Organization (WHO)
has a complete listing of health legislation worldwide which is broader than specific acupuncture and Oriental medicine laws and regulations. However, it is still necessary for acupuncture and Oriental Medicine Practitioners to know these for their country because many of the laws pertain to national, state or provincial regulations are ones that apply to ALL health practitioners. FOR THOSE PROVINCES, STATES AND COUNTRIES INTERESTED IN LEGISLATION
FOR ACUPUNCTURE AND ORIENTAL MEDICINE

Legislative Handbook and Model Bill for the Practice Of Acupuncture & Oriental Medicine This publication (63 pages, $18), by Barbara Mitchell, J.D., L.Ac., is published by the National Acupuncture Foundation. The Acupuncture Foundation and Acupuncture and Oriental Medicine Alliance in the US have assisted a number of countries regarding legislation.
